Difficult question. The answer could be just a faction choice, who's your warcaster/warlock or what is actually in the army.

So at the moment I mostly play Cryx though I have dabbled with Protectorate and Highborn Covenant in the past.

Currently I've been playing Deneghra1, Skarre1, Scaverous, Goreshade2 and Mortenebra. Both the Asphyxious', Goreshade1 and Venethrax but not recently and Goreshade2 I'm still trying to make work competitively but I'm having fun learning about his tricks.

As for what I'm using in my forces. I'm attempting to step away from the bane thralls (not that successfully with Goreshade ). Blackbane ghost raiders, Satyxis, Bonejacks and mechanithalls are likely to feature in my lists with Bloodgorgers, Nyss hunters and bane knights coming in second.

As for solos, you'll see the warwitch sirens, Gorman, Gerlak and Tartarus.

Are you asking so you can learn about what you'll face in casual games or tournaments? In casual games I've found that anything goes. The silly end of the theme lists can come out, people playing mangled metal vs normal armies and fun scenarios like the ones in the mk i book escalation. Tournament games are when the seemingly powerful stuff comes into the picture. In Cryx this is seen to be Asphyxious2, both Deneghra's (but 2 more than 1) and Skarre2. Putting those casters with the Deathjack, Nightmare and Tartarus (and banes) will be seen as a massively aggressive thing to do so prepare for that if that's what you want to go for.
